Register of Charities - The Charity Commission HUNDRED HOUSE VILLAGE HALL ALSO KNOWN AS JAMES VAUGHAN MEMORIAL HALL
Activities - how the charity spends its money
Management committee provide facility, comprising main hall seating 120 people, committee room seating 30, modern kitchen, modern toilets/disabled, disabled ramp/access, large stage, dressing rooms, curtains, spot lights, post office, short mat bowls mat and equipment, car park charges reasonable, suitable for conferences/parties.
